Output 16595ea529348565aa0395db3deaa7ef9ce8bfbbca683d3d17e9ac938034ea48:3

value
204908830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d1b2bfa5bac20c13c0a3688fffc43780f6df819 OP_EQUAL
address
37G7hB4wJeE7c7fhAowWzQWwyFeHnQZwDd
transaction
16595ea529348565aa0395db3deaa7ef9ce8bfbbca683d3d17e9ac938034ea48
spent
true